You shouldn’t need to plumb the system into your water line because you’ll already have a dedicated setup for your existing softener. part time job in brampton for studentsWebbBasically, a water softener reduces hard tap water at 300 ppm (or 17.5 GPG) to soft water (below 60 ppm or 3.5 GPG). For example, to turn 1 gallon of hard tap water into soft water, we would need 14-grain capacity: 17.5 GPG – 3.5 GPG = 14-grain capacity.
